🔥🔥95% of firefighters are not professionals?! Today was a fun city festival! My daughters had the chance to pose on a fire truck and were totally excited🤩 I learned today from a Firefighter that that 👉Firefighting operations due to actual Fires are 12 times less likely than Emergency rescues 👀 👉95% of firefighters in Germany are volunteers‼️, that’s why youth engagement of the fire department is so crucial Some numbers (I love statistics 🤓): Causes of fires: - Electricity (28%) ⚡ Deployment statistics 2022: - Emergency medical services: 2,436,919 🚑 - Technical assistance: 659,662 🔧 - Patient transport: 526,482 🚑 - False alarms: 350,613 🔕 - Fires and explosions: 197,834 🔥 - Animals/insects: 39,788 🦁🐝 - Disaster alarms: 174 ☢️ Btw: it takes only 8 weeks of training that can be done in the evening and on Saturdays until you are allowed to join rolling out on a mission in the fire truck. And your employer has to enable your service by law and you get a compensation. Would you do it? #Firefighters #Volunteers #Heroes #Youth #thankyouforyourservice #feuerwehr

A rip is a type of current which sometimes can looks calm and idyllic to swim in but infact is a treacherous current which can drag you out to sea. Know what to do to help prevent further casualties to this crule hazard.
On 31 May 2023, a warm sunny spell hit Britain, driving many people to the coast to enjoy a day at the beach. Tragically, a rip current hit Bournemouth on the same day and two of these beach-goers didn't make it home to their families. Their names were Joe and Sunnah. They were just 17 and 12 years old. This is their story, told by their loving mums, Ness and Steph... These remarkable women have channelled their grief into a mission to prevent future tragedies, joining forces with RLSS UK to campaign for better water safety education. Make a plan today. Your family may not be together if a disaster strikes, so it’s important to know how you will respond. Decide how you’ll contact one another and reconnect if separated. Establish a family meeting place that’s familiar and easy to find.
